Microsoft revealed a new batch of indie titles heading to its Xbox Game Pass service during an ID@Xbox presentation. Now that the company has introduced a new PC Game Pass tier, it is splitting its announcements up by platform: one set that will appear on both Xbox One and PC, and another that is PC-only.On both platforms, Game Pass will be adding My Time At Portia, Bad North, GoNNOR, The Banner Saga 3, Yoku`s Island Express, and Worms WMD. On PC, it will add Undertale, Timespinner, Unavowed, Machinarium, and For The King. It`s worth noting that some games being added to PC, like For the King, were already available on the console service, so Microsoft is still catching up to give the two versions of Game Pass parity.Xbox Game Pass is a subscription service, offering a library of more than 100 games for $10 per month. Microsoft recently launched Xbox Game Pass Ultimate, which bundles the PC and console service with Xbox Live Gold, for $15 per month. But thanks to a quirk in how the system works, you can actually save a bundle on it.The company tends to announce a few weeks of Game Pass games at a time, most recently announcing the new additions through the end of June. Those included Rare Replay and Goat Simulator, among others.
